
Afghanistan has announced their 16-member squad for the upcoming T20I leg of their tour to Bangladesh, with star spinner Rashid Khan making a return to the side. Rashid had been sidelined for the majority of the series due to fitness issues but has now regained his spot in the squad. He missed the one-off Test match, which resulted in a defeat for Afghanistan by a staggering 546 runs against Bangladesh.
In preparation for the T20I series, Afghanistan has assembled a star-studded squad that includes the likes of Mohammad Shahzad, Mohammad Nabi, and Mujeeb Ur Rahman. The two-match T20I series is scheduled to be played from July 14 to July 16. Prior to that, an ODI contest between the two teams will take place from July 5 to July 11. Rashid will also feature in the three-match ODI series against Bangladesh.

While the ODI series holds significance for both teams, Bangladesh has made their squad selection with an eye on the World Cup 2023. Notably, Shakib Al Hasan will be a notable presence in the Bangladesh squad after missing the one-off Test against Afghanistan due to a finger injury sustained during the ODI series against Ireland in May earlier this year.
The first match of the ODI series is set to take place on July 5, followed by the second ODI on July 8, and the third and final match on July 11. All matches will be held at the same venue, Chattogram.

Bangladesh squad for ODI: Tamim Iqbal (c), Litton Das, Najmul Hossain Shanto, Shakib Al Hasan, Mushfiqur Rahim, Towhid Hridoy, Mehidy Hasan Miraz, Taijul Islam, Taskin Ahmed, Ebadot Hossain Chowdhury, Mustafizur Rahman, Hasan Mahmud, Shoriful Islam, Afif Hossain Dhrubo, Naim Sheikh.
Afghanistan Squad for T20Is: Rashid Khan (c), Rahmanullah Gurbaz, Hazratullah Zazai, Mohammad Shahzad, Ibrahim Zadran, Mohammad Nabi, Najibullah Zadran, Sediq Atal, Karim Janat, Azmatullah Omarzai, Fazalhaq Farooqi, Naveen-ul-Haq, Wafadar Momand, Farid Ahmad Malik, Noor Ahmad, Mujeeb Ur Rahman
ODI and T20I series schedule*:
5 July, First ODI, Chattogram
8 July, Second ODI, Chattogram
11 July, Third ODI, Chattogram
14 July, First T20I, Sylhet
16 July, Second T20I, Sylhet
*All Matches are Day-Night games
